Facebook Twitter LinkedIn What substance released during exercise is called “Miracle-Gro for the brain?” Serotonin Dopamine Br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F) Insulin-like growth factor one (IGF-1) Br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F) gets its fun nickname because it’s like a “fertilizer” for your brain — it can promote growth and help make your mind more resilient to stress and aging.
